What's the difference between a Boolean function and a Boolean expression?

Respuesta :

ExieFansler ExieFansler
  • 17-09-2019

Explanation:

A boolean function is a function in any programming language whose return type is boolean means a function that returns true or false.For ex:-

bool func(int a,int b)

{

     if(a>b)

return true;

else

return false;

}

An expression is a combination of one or more variables,constants,operators,function and which is computed and produces a value in case of boolean expression the value that is calculated is either true or false.

for ex:-     bool result= a>b  && a>c;
